How to Send a Contract for Signature via SpotDraft Native E-Sign
SpotDraft's e-signature feature makes it easy to send contracts for digital signatures, streamlining your workflow and enhancing security. This guide will walk you through the process of sending a contract for signature within SpotDraft.
Step 1: Upload the Contract
Note: While .doc, .docx, and .pdf formats are supported for initial contract upload, certain features have specific format requirements. See the notes in Step 2 for stamp uploads and executed contract version uploads.
Step 2: Add Additional Data
Counterparty: Choose the counterparty from the provided list. You can also add a new counterparty by typing their name and email address in the provided field.
Note: To add new counterparties, you must have the “Manage Counterparties” permission enabled for your team. If you can only select from the existing dropdown list and cannot add new counterparties, contact your Admin team to request this permission. Permissions are applied at the team level, so your Admin will need to enable this for your entire team.
